I like to run it somewhere inbetween personally.

For races that have +2/+1 (which most races have) I rule that they **MUST** put the +2 into one of those stats and then the +1 can go anywhere.

For example lets use a Wood elf & a High elf.

The woodelf usually gets +2 Dex & +1 Wis, I say they get +2 to *either* Dex or Wis and then +1 any.
The highelf usually gets +2 Dex & +1 Int, I say they get +2 to *either* Dex or Int and then +1 any.
